lighttpd 1.4.21
По сравнению с прошлой версией внесено 34 изменения.
Наиболее интересные новшества:
- Решено удалить из поставки скрипт spawn-fcgi начиная со следующего релиза. spawn-fcgi в будущем будет развиваться как отдельный проект.
- Из-за многочисленных жалоб возвращена старая логика работы mod_rewrite и mod_redirect. Внимание, не используйте редирект для защиты скрытых URL, злоумышленник легко может обойти правила редиректа через экранирование параметров запроса (url-encoded);
- Исправлена проблема, возникающая при достижении лимита server.max-connections;
- Протокол SSLv2 теперь запрещен в настройках по умолчанию;
- Новый параметр конфигурации "server.reject-expect-100-with-417", для запрещения вывода кода 417 в случае получения заголовка "Expect: 100-continue";
- Строковые значения в числовых параметрах конфигурации теперь автоматически приводятся к числовому типу (удобно при использовании переменных окружения для формирования конфигурации);
- В mod_compress реализована поддержка кеширования через теги etags и last-modified;
- По умолчанию в лог теперь не помещаются записи о завершении соединения по таймауту. Вернуть записи в лог можно через переменную debug.log-timeouts = "enable";
- В условиях теперь можно использовать $HTTP["language"], например:Code
$HTTP["language"] =~ "(de|it|hr)" {
url.redirect = ( "^/$" => "http://www.site.net/%1/" )
}
Downloads (~643 Kb)_http://www.lighttpd.n...1.4.21.tar.bz2